FLO4565154 Stage costume in the Watteau style for Le Petite Abbe (a play by Bocage and Liorat with music by Grisart). In silk suit with short cape, shoes with silver buckles, and tricorn. Handcoloured lithograph after a design by Leon Sault from " L'Art du Travestissement" (The Art of Fancy Dress), Paris, c.1880.
